Introduction
A proof market is a platform that facilitates the buying and selling of cryptographic proofs. These proofs are used to verify the integrity and authenticity of data and transactions. Proof markets enable users to access verified proofs without independently generating them, streamlining verification processes.
The role of proof markets in verifying data and transactions is vital for modern digital ecosystems. By offering a standardized platform, they enhance trust and transparency in decentralized systems. Proof markets strengthen security frameworks, ensuring reliable data validation.
Types of Cryptographic Proofs
Cryptographic proofs used in proof markets include various types, each tailored to specific applications. Zero-knowledge proofs allow one party to prove the possession of information without revealing the information itself. This enhances privacy while maintaining verifiability. Verifiable computation ensures computational outputs are correct, supporting efficient and secure processing.
Key types of cryptographic proofs include:
- Zero-Knowledge Proofs: Enable privacy-preserving validation.
- Verifiable Computation: Guarantee correctness of computational results.
- Merkle Proofs: Validate data within blockchains efficiently.
These proofs cater to diverse use cases, providing robust methods for ensuring authenticity.
Use Cases of Proof Markets
Proof markets serve essential functions across various industries. In supply chain management, they verify the provenance of goods, ensuring transparency and reducing counterfeiting risks. Auditing systems use proof markets to validate financial records, enhancing trust in organizational operations.
Beyond supply chain and auditing, proof markets support digital identity verification, fraud detection, and compliance monitoring. Their versatility makes them crucial for sectors requiring reliable validation processes.
Benefits of Using Proof Markets
Proof markets offer significant advantages. Efficiency improves as users access pre-verified cryptographic proofs, reducing the need for complex calculations. Security strengthens with standardized proofs, minimizing risks of manipulation or error.
Challenges arise in creating a unified and accessible proof market. Hardware compatibility, privacy concerns, and scalability limit adoption. Overcoming these hurdles ensures widespread use and maximizes the benefits of proof markets.
Challenges of Standardized Proof Markets
Establishing a standardized proof market involves addressing multiple challenges. Compatibility between cryptographic algorithms and platforms is essential for seamless integration. Privacy concerns must be resolved, protecting sensitive data from exposure.
Scalability remains another challenge, as proof markets must handle large volumes of transactions effectively. Collaborative efforts among developers, organizations, and regulators are necessary to overcome these limitations.
